What is a "complex partial" seizure?

The complex partial seizures are a lot different than the simple partial seizures. The complex really arise principally in temporal lobe structures, but they're different in that the person is actually unconscious. Now, these complex partials may just be a loss of consciousness or they could also generalize and become a generalized type of seizure.
